Kylie Osbourne Style: Trendy Outfits & Makeup Tips

Kelly Osbourne carved a distinct niche in the global pop culture landscape, transitioning from reality television fame to a multifaceted career that encompasses music, television hosting, fashion, and outspoken advocacy. Her style journey, marked by a bold departure from conventional celebrity aesthetics, offers a masterclass in authentic self-expression. Understanding Kelly Osbourne style is about recognizing a fearless evolution, a blend of punk rebellion, high-fashion drama, and a practical ease that refuses to be dictated by trends.

The Evolution of a Style Icon

Early in the public eye, during the peak of "The Osbournes," Kelly’s aesthetic was firmly rooted in the grunge and skater punk scenes. Think oversized flannel shirts, combat boots, and a deliberate disregard for polished glamour. This wasn't just a phase; it was a statement. As she matured, so did her wardrobe. The look shifted from purely rebellious to strategically edgy, incorporating elements of rock chic, vintage glamour, and sharp tailoring. This progression feels organic, a reflection of personal growth rather than a pursuit of fleeting fame, which is likely why it resonates so deeply with fans.

Key Pillars of Her Signature Look

Certain elements consistently anchor Kelly Osbourne style, creating a cohesive visual identity. She masterfully balances seemingly disparate pieces, making high-low fashion feel effortless. Key components include a distinct love for dark, saturated colors like deep plum, inky black, and hunter green. Her silhouettes often lean towards the structured and tailored, whether it's a sharp blazer or a bodycon dress that highlights her frame. Accessorizing is where she truly shines, with statement sunglasses, bold jewelry, and eclectic hats serving as her signature exclamation points.

Decoding the Kelly Osbourne Wardrobe

To emulate Kelly’s aesthetic without copying it, one must focus on attitude and key wardrobe staples over exact replication. Her approach is about confidence in mixing and matching. A ripped band t-shirt can be paired with a sophisticated pencil skirt. A vintage-inspired dress can be grounded with modern, chunky boots. This juxtaposition is central to her appeal—it’s unexpected and refreshably real. Below is a breakdown of essential items that frequently appear in her looks:

Staple Item
How Kelly Styles It
Why It Works
Oversized Blazer
Worn off-shoulder with a fitted top and high-waisted trousers.
Creates an androgynous, powerful silhouette while balancing feminine curves.
Graphic Tee
Tucked into a pleated skirt or paired with tailored joggers.
Adds an instant edge and personality, preventing an outfit from feeling too polished.
Statement Boots
Ankle boots with a chunky sole or classic Chelsea boots, worn with dresses or jeans.
Grounds delicate or feminine pieces, adding practicality and a rock edge.
Oversized Sunglasses
Often paired with a messy bun or dramatic cat-eye makeup.
Instantly elevates a casual look and adds an aura of mystery and cool.
